
AppManager by CompanyDNA AI is an AI-driven IT agent designed for app, user, and subscription management. It offers a centralized dashboard to seamlessly integrate, streamline, and control all apps. With AppManager, tasks like user provisioning are simplified, spending is optimized, and productivity is enhanced. The tool allows users to focus on growth while it efficiently manages their IT-related operations. Key features include user provisioning, subscription management, employee cost breakdown, enhanced license cost tracking, smart spending insights, and AI-powered app recommendations.
AppManager by CompanyDNA AI was created by Furkan Ozata, Omer Faruk Aydin, and Hamdi Hakan Karakaya.
